Question 1

A job shop has 3 machines. Jobs and their routes: - Job A: M1 → M2 → M3 with times 33, 32, 40 - Job B: M3 → M1 → M2 with times 29, 24, 29 - Job C: M2 → M1 → M3 with times 20, 29, 26 What is a lower bound on the minimum makespan?
Step-by-step solution:

1. Machine load bound: 95
2. Job processing bound: 105
3. Lower bound: 105

Answer: 105
